Check If Your Smart TV Has Bluetooth
Most smart TVs include some form of Bluetooth support, but it’s commonly limited to remotes, maintenance, or specific accessories rather than general headphone/speaker pairing. The fastest way to confirm is to check your TV’s Settings first, then verify against your exact model’s published specifications (not generic brand info).
“Bluetooth” support is usually visible in the TV’s Settings under Connections or Remotes & Accessories, if the feature is enabled for your model.
Bluetooth audio pairing is typically exposed as “Bluetooth Audio,” “Bluetooth Speaker,” or “Bluetooth Headphones,” rather than as standard device pairing.
Bluetooth operates in the 2.4 GHz band, so the TV and headset/speaker need to support compatible Bluetooth profiles for audio to work.
– Look for “Bluetooth” in your TV’s Settings menu (often under Remotes & Accessories or Connections)
– Check the TV model specs on the manufacturer website
– Confirm whether it lists audio devices like headphones or speakers
What to look for in Settings (so you don’t get misled)
When you open your TV’s Settings, don’t just search for “Bluetooth”—look for what it can connect to. On many sets, Bluetooth exists for:
– Remote control pairing (especially for voice remotes)
– Mobile app control (phone as a remote)
– Specific accessories (e.g., keyboards, game controllers, or service tools)
– Audio output (headphones/speakers) — only if the TV exposes audio pairing options
In my testing across multiple living-room setups, I’ve found that “Bluetooth” alone is not enough information. The deciding factor is whether you see an option like “Add Bluetooth Device” inside an audio-focused area (sometimes called *Bluetooth Audio*).

Verify with your exact model number (important)
Even within the same brand, Bluetooth support can differ by year, region, and model line. For verification:
1. Find the model number on the TV label or Settings → Support/About.
2. Search the manufacturer site for that exact model’s specs.
3. Look for keywords such as:
– “Bluetooth Audio”
– “Headphone”
– “A2DP” (Advanced Audio Distribution Profile)
– “LE Audio” (Bluetooth LE Audio—newer, lower-latency approach)

Bluetooth for Audio: What to Expect
If your TV supports Bluetooth audio, you’ll typically be able to connect headphones or Bluetooth speakers as output, not as full “paired devices” like a phone. Many TVs implement “audio Bluetooth” in a limited way—great for listening, but sometimes not ideal for gaming or multi-device setups.
Some smart TVs support Bluetooth audio output only, meaning you can stream sound to a headset but not necessarily manage advanced device features.
Range and pairing stability depend on both the TV’s Bluetooth implementation and your headset/speaker’s codec and profile support.
Bluetooth audio latency can be noticeable for video—especially with simple codecs—so the codec used (SBC/AAC/aptX/LDAC/LE Audio) matters.
– Some smart TVs support Bluetooth audio output only (not full device pairing)
– Range and pairing stability can vary by brand and firmware
– If supported, pairing is usually done through a Bluetooth Devices scan
“Bluetooth audio” can still be restrictive
Here’s what often changes across brands and model years:
– Only one Bluetooth audio device at a time (common)
– No simultaneous TV speaker + Bluetooth output (common)
– Limited controls (volume sometimes works, sometimes doesn’t)
– Codec selection limits (some TVs only use SBC or AAC)
The practical impact is simple: your TV may “pair,” but audio may be delayed, mono, or unstable. From my own experience, if you see Bluetooth audio options but they repeatedly disconnect, the problem is often firmware-related or because the headset expects a codec the TV doesn’t prioritize.
Codec reality check: latency varies widely
Bluetooth audio latency depends heavily on the codec and system buffering. For business and performance-minded users (meetings, watching with subtitles, or gaming), this is where expectations need calibration.
Typical Bluetooth Audio Codec Latency (Estimated Ranges)
| # | Bluetooth Audio Codec / Mode | Typical End-to-End Latency | Use Case Fit | Latency Rating |
|---|---|---|---|---|
| 1 | SBC (Common Bluetooth Default) | 160–220 ms | Music & general TV | ★ ★ ★☆☆ |
| 2 | AAC (Apple/Many Devices) | 140–200 ms | Video & music | ★ ★ ★☆☆ |
| 3 | aptX (Classic) | 70–120 ms | Movies & casual gaming | ★ ★ ★ ★☆ |
| 4 | aptX HD | 55–95 ms | Lower-latency music | ★ ★ ★ ★☆ |
| 5 | LDAC (Sony) | 65–105 ms | High-quality listening | ★ ★ ★ ★☆ |
| 6 | LC3 via Bluetooth LE Audio | 20–35 ms | Gaming/low-lag scenarios | ★ ★ ★ ★ ★ |
| 7 | Proprietary “Low-Latency” Modes | 25–50 ms | Best-effort low lag | ★ ★ ★ ★ ★ |

Quick pros/cons: Bluetooth audio vs transmitter vs soundbar
If you’re deciding what to buy, it helps to compare options by the outcome you care about: pairing effort, latency, and stability.
| Option | Pros | Cons |
|---|---|---|
| TV Bluetooth Audio (if supported) | No extra hardware; simple pairing UI on many models | Latency/codec limits; sometimes one-device limit |
| Bluetooth Transmitter | Works with non-Bluetooth TVs; stable pairing to one transmitter | Extra box/power; still depends on your transmitter codec |
| Wi‑Fi/Bluetooth Soundbar or Streaming Speakers | Often better synchronization; ecosystem features (apps, multiroom) | Costs more; may require app setup |

How to Pair Bluetooth Devices
If your TV supports Bluetooth audio, pairing is usually straightforward and takes only a few minutes. The critical steps are putting the headphone/speaker into pairing mode first and then using the TV’s Bluetooth devices scan.
Headphones/speakers must be placed into pairing mode before the TV can detect them in a Bluetooth Devices scan.
If the TV offers “Add Device” or “Pair New Device,” that workflow is the most reliable way to establish an A2DP audio connection.
After pairing, your TV audio output must be set to the Bluetooth device to avoid “paired but silent” behavior.
– Put your headphones/speaker into pairing mode first
– On the TV, select Add Device or Pair New Device in Bluetooth settings
– Test audio playback and adjust output settings if needed
Step-by-step pairing (reliable workflow)
1. Turn on the TV and open Settings.
2. Navigate to Bluetooth (or Bluetooth Audio).
3. Put your headphones/speaker into pairing mode:
– Usually holding the pairing button until an LED flashes.
4. In the TV, choose Add Device / Pair New Device.
5. Select your device from the scan results.
6. Play a short video/audio clip to validate:
– Confirm audio plays immediately
– Confirm volume responds correctly
– Check for delay and stability
From my experience, pairing fails most often when:
– The headset exits pairing mode too quickly (do the scan immediately).
– The TV is still connected to another Bluetooth audio device.
– The TV is paired, but the audio output is not switched.
If pairing works but audio is missing
Try these in order:
– Re-select the Bluetooth device under Audio Output.
– Restart the TV and device (quick reset).
– Forget/delete the device entry on the TV, then re-pair.
Q: Why does my TV show the headset in Bluetooth settings but there’s no sound?
Most commonly the TV’s audio output is still routed to internal speakers or a different output—switch the Audio Output to the paired Bluetooth device.
If Your Smart TV Doesn’t Have Bluetooth
If your TV lacks Bluetooth audio support, don’t treat it as a dead end—wireless listening still works well with the right adapter or ecosystem. The most reliable workaround is usually a Bluetooth transmitter connected to a TV audio output, or moving to a soundbar/speakers that match your wireless needs.
A Bluetooth transmitter converts the TV’s wired audio output (optical or headphone out) into a Bluetooth audio stream for headphones/speakers.
If your goal is low-latency video playback, Wi‑Fi soundbars and streaming speakers often outperform basic Bluetooth setups.
Casting behavior depends on the TV and app; Bluetooth casting is not universally supported across streaming apps.
– Use a Bluetooth transmitter connected to the TV’s audio out (headphone jack/optical)
– Consider Wi-Fi/Bluetooth soundbars or streaming speakers that match your TV ecosystem
– Try casting via Bluetooth-capable apps (depends on the TV and device)
Best alternatives (choose by your use case)
Here are practical scenarios I see frequently in real homes and small offices:
– You want private listening with minimal setup
Use a transmitter to your TV’s headphone jack or optical output, then pair your existing Bluetooth headphones to the transmitter.
– You care about lip-sync and stability
Consider a Wi‑Fi soundbar or a streaming speaker system. It reduces reliance on Bluetooth audio codecs and often improves sync.
– You already own an ecosystem (Google Cast, Alexa, Apple AirPlay, etc.)
Pick the audio solution that integrates with your TV/app ecosystem first to avoid extra “route switching.”
Q: What’s the simplest workaround when the TV has no Bluetooth?
A Bluetooth transmitter on the TV’s audio output is typically the fastest, lowest-cost path to wireless headphone listening.
Q: Optical output vs headphone jack—what’s better for transmitters?
Optical is often more consistent (digital audio, less interference), while headphone jack can be convenient but depends on TV volume/headphone settings.
What to check before buying a transmitter
– Output type: Does your TV have optical, RCA, or only headphone out?
– Codec support: Look for transmitter support for modern codecs if your headphones support them.
– Latency mode: Some transmitters explicitly offer low-latency options for video.
– Power and pairing: You want quick “auto-pair” behavior.
Common Bluetooth Issues (and Fixes)
Most Bluetooth problems are solvable once you isolate whether the issue is pairing, routing, or firmware compatibility. The fastest troubleshooting approach is to restart both devices, update firmware, and confirm audio output routing.
Restarting both the TV and the Bluetooth device often clears stale Bluetooth pairing states and restores stable discovery.
Updating TV firmware can improve Bluetooth compatibility because manufacturers frequently patch profile or connection-handling issues.
Correct audio routing is required—paired devices will not output audio unless the TV audio output is set to them.
– Restart both the TV and the Bluetooth device, then try pairing again
– Update the TV firmware to improve compatibility
– Ensure the TV audio output is set to the paired Bluetooth device
Issue → likely cause → fix
Pairing fails (no devices found)
– Cause: headset not in pairing mode, TV Bluetooth disabled, or another device is already connected
– Fix: re-enter pairing mode; restart; remove the device entry and re-scan
Connects, then drops audio
– Cause: weak signal path, codec mismatch, or firmware bugs
– Fix: shorten distance; avoid obstacles; update firmware; try a different output mode
Audio is one-sided / low volume
– Cause: profile mismatch (e.g., headset using call profile rather than audio streaming)
– Fix: ensure the connection is A2DP audio; switch audio output and re-pair
Lip-sync delay
– Cause: codec latency and TV buffering
– Fix: try headphones that support aptX/LDAC/LE Audio; consider transmitter with low-latency or switch to a soundbar
According to Bluetooth SIG guidance, LE Audio and modern codec implementations are designed to improve latency characteristics over legacy audio paths (2019–2024). In practical terms, if you consistently see delay with Bluetooth audio, the fix is rarely “tweak a setting”—it’s usually “switch to a lower-latency path.”
